Amazing! We spent five nights staying in a deluxe king room with terrace/balcony at The Purple Horse Hotel in Beijing at the end of June 2026.. The location is excellent. The hotel is situated in the heart of a Hutong which offers a calm quiet and serene experience in the middle of a bustling city, only a short walk to restaurants and shops. The Hutong itself is a great experience, it's safe and friendly and we enjoyed chatting to the locals at the corner shop. The hotel is absolutely wonderful. It's less than two years old and It is finished to a really high standard, the attention to detail is incredible. It felt luxurious with the highest quality furnishings and the bathroom and shower were like something you would find in a spa. Our room had great views over the Hutong and the Beijing skyline and had excellent air conditioning. We had a buffet breakfast and a buffet dinner included and it was delicious and served in a beautiful restaurant on the top floor. Above that there was an amazing rooftop terrace with an outdoor swimming pool, a cocktail bar and 360⁰ views of the city. There is also a Peking duck restaurant on the ground floor, a gym and a self service complimentary laundry room. The best thing about this hotel is the staff. Excellent location near Tiananmen, Forbidden City and Wangfujing (all walkable). Subway just 10 mins away on foot, bus stop right outside with the major sight seeing lines. No breakfast provided but there’s enough food places around and an in house cafe. Room is clean and well sized, good for 2 big luggage open on the floor with space to walk and a large closet. Shampoo/ bath gel, slippers, toothbrushes provided. Shower has good water pressure although curtain is short so water tends to get out of the bath area, nothing a towel can’t solve. Shoutout to the front desk staff (Miss Tian/Liu/Zhang/Li) for their friendliness and helpfulness, esp to Miss Li (night desk) for her quick initiative and service recovery after a miscommunication on room cleaning early in our stay. Love the roof terrace. We were on the first floor and felt that the soundproofing was good.
